My job as a coach is to:
1. Believe in you
2. Challenge you
3. Be patient with you
4. Listen to you
5. Get to know you
6. Empower you
7. Push you to want more
8. Lead you
9. Love you
10. Equip you for the game (AND for life)
Players: A good game shouldn’t satisfy U & a bad game shouldn’t affect your confidence. Ups & downs are part of the game & for the most part, are out of your control. Your focus should be on your work ethic, your plan & staying in the gym. Improvement brings more highs than lows.

The higher the level you play at the more you will need to focus on taking care of your body off of the court. Make sure you are valuing your recovery time and fueling your body with the things that it needs to perform at an elite level.
Great offensive teams do these:
🏀Great spacing
🏀Make the extra pass
🏀Play inside out
🏀Play fast, but under control
🏀Set great screens
🏀Take high percentage shots
🏀Take advantage of D mistakes
🏀Don’t care who scores
